Heinfels

Heinfels is a municipality in the district of Lienz in the state of . It is most known as the site of Burg Heinfels, and the gateway to the Loacker factory.

Castle
is an extensive hilltop castle complex above Heinfels in East Tyrol. The strategically well-situated fortification at 1130 metres above sea level is a striking landmark of the eastern .
